We need to identify all the valves and instruments in the process, both at the physical locations and on the P&IDs. Does anybody have any general suggestions for this? What would a suitable numbering system be?

Also, on these slides:


they show various instruments around one device using the same number (slide 5). Is this best practice?

In addition to the letters, each device within an loop carry the same number - the loop number.

Instrument numbers may be structured to identify the lop location.
A good approach is to tie the PID number to a particular area (physical location), and then to sequentially number the instruments on that PID. For example, PID 25 carries up to 100 loops, or instrument loop numbers 2500 to 2599.
